Transaction 37d28cedffb700e890fe21c794a852acd65bf9d2f6abb2eeaf2b15adabf96132
1 Input
1 Output
-
37d28cedffb700e890fe21c794a852acd65bf9d2f6abb2eeaf2b15adabf96132:0
- value
- 311446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9419123ae03958c68e992a90d4b55208f087f6d OP_EQUAL
- address
- 3JaZUhnSnjLHMKj1L2qxdeoRQVV8NQ2ji2